Understanding Gum Disease

Gum disease, also known as periodontal disease, is a common oral health condition that affects the gums and supporting structures of the teeth. It starts with the accumulation of plaque, a sticky film of bacteria that forms on the teeth. If left untreated, gum disease can progress and cause inflammation, gum recession, tooth loss, and even impact overall health.

FAQs about CBD and Gum Disease

Here are some frequently asked questions regarding CBD’s potential in treating gum disease:

1. Will CBD make me feel high?

No, CBD is a non-psychoactive compound in cannabis. It does not have the intoxicating effects associated with THC, another compound found in cannabis.

2. Is CBD legal?

In many countries and states, CBD derived from hemp is legal, as it contains negligible amounts of THC. However, it’s important to check local regulations to ensure compliance.

4. Can CBD replace traditional oral care practices?

No, CBD should not replace traditional oral care practices such as toothbrushing, flossing, and regular dental check-ups. It can be used as a complementary tool to promote gum health.

5. Are there any side effects of using CBD for gum disease?

While CBD is generally well-tolerated, some individuals may experience mild side effects such as dry mouth, diarrhea, or fatigue. It is advisable to start with a low dosage and consult with a healthcare professional if you have any concerns.
